    Can't say for sure about the locked galleries (SM is in R/O mode right now), but I did manage to fix/circumvent the saved login info problem.

    It appears Smugbrowser (or more likely FF) "moved" the file that stores the login info (smugbrowser.xml) from "smugbrowser" in the root directory of your FF profile to a fairly deep sub-directory inside the extensions subdirectory (\extensions\{FBD8D33E-0FF7-4a71-BE2F-FD0B6F3C64A9}\chrome\content\accounts).

    I almost have to wonder if the entire path is too long... Its over 160 characters, not including the actual file name.

    Anyway, I opened the xml file in the "old" directory and copied the contents into the (empty) xml file in the "new" directory and the login info is there now when I launch Smugbrowser.

    can you give the path for the "old" directory?
    On my (WinXP) system the old path is/was:

    \Documents and Settings\username\Application Data\Mozilla\Firefox\Profiles\rndgibberish.default\smugbrowser\smugbrowser.xml

    The two in bold will likely be different on your system.


    And just for completeness, the entire new path is:

    \Documents and Settings\username\Application Data\Mozilla\Firefox\Profiles\rndgibberish.default\extensions\{FBD8D33E-0FF7-4a71-BE2F-FD0B6F3C64A9}\chrome\content\accounts\smugbrowser.xml

    Its possible (don't know enough about FF extension) that the extension directory for Smugbrowser ({FBD8D33E-0FF7-4a71-BE2F-FD0B6F3C64A9}) could be different from system to system.
